Trade book publishing depends on new writers or authors. These authors, out of their research or knowledge, write and submit their work for publication to the publisher. Fortunately if the author happens to be rich and able to afford publishing his book, then the author himself is the publisher in this case. The work submitted will be reviewed by a committee which has a team of professional editors who are experts in the subject. This team will go through the new works waiting for publication and select the suitable ones for publication; suitable ones mean those which have good subject value as well as commercial value. Any book can be a success only when it is able to give commercial returns on investment. This is possible if the book is able to create a sensation among the people and is useful for them

Once the article or work is considered for trade book publishing, the publisher will enter into a legal deal with the author in terms of payments and copyright which is governed by the local as well as international laws. This is very important because it will avoid frictions and unwanted hassles at a later date when the book does well commercially and enters successive editions. The next step in the publishing industry is typesetting. For this part of the job, the publishing house either has its own staff or has freelance people who complete the work on a commission basis. After the desk top publishing work is done it has to be proofread by a team of editors. Proof reading is an important step in publishing because a poor proof reading will not create the expected impact in the mind of the reader.

The success of the trade book publishing also depends on the marketing and the sales strength of the publishing house. A strong marketing and sales network is needed to take the trade book to various retail book outlets. Any excellent work will go unnoticed and all the efforts towards the writing will be wasted if it is not distributed properly and made available to the public in their own area. This is why marketing and sales are important sectors of trade book publishing.
